About Yintong Li

Yintong Li is a scholar working on Artificial Intelligence, Computational Theory and Mathematics and Aerospace Engineering, having authored 19 papers that have together received 426 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Metaheuristic Optimization Algorithms Research (15 papers), Evolutionary Algorithms and Applications (8 papers), Advanced Multi-Objective Optimization Algorithms (6 papers), Guidance and Control Systems (5 papers), Military Defense Systems Analysis (3 papers), Robotic Path Planning Algorithms (3 papers), Data Stream Mining Techniques (2 papers) and Nuclear reactor physics and engineering (1 paper). The work is most often cited by research in Artificial Intelligence (330 citations), Computational Theory and Mathematics (149 citations) and Industrial and Manufacturing Engineering (32 citations). Yintong Li has collaborated with scholars based in China, United States and Russia. Frequent co-authors include Tong Han, Zhenglei Wei, Xiaofei Wang, Huan Zhou, Shangqin Tang, Hui Zhao, Yuan Wang, Yuan Wang, Yujie Wei and Hao Xu. Their work appears in journals such as IEEE Access, Information Sciences, Complex & Intelligent Systems, Swarm and Evolutionary Computation and Computational Intelligence and Neuroscience.
